Adjective [Ancient Greek]

Etymology: From παν- (pan-, “very, all”) + σοφός (sophós, “wise”).   1. very wise, very learned Synonyms: πᾰντόσοφος (pantósophos) (english: most clever), πᾰ́σσοφος (pássophos)

Adjective [Greek]

IPA: /ˈpansofos/

  1. omniscient, all-knowing, pansophic

  2. very learned or wise
